100 Languages

A spurt of languages from India and Africa has finally taken our Great Translation Project over the top. We rejoice to report that 100 languages are now on our website. We praise our wonderful Lord Jesus, and we thank you for your prayers and support.

What now? Not all languages on our website have all 60 Bible stories translated, so there is much work to complete them. Then there are a few thousand more languages. So, while we celebrate the completion of this first goal, we will not slow down as we go forward.

We will continue to target the 100 largest people groups, of which there are 33 languages left to do (see list below.)

The Next Great Priority

The panel to the right shows the next great priority of languages Bible For Children wants to have translated so the children of these cultures and countries may have access to the Bible stories. We are praying that God will touch the hearts of those who can make it happen.

These languages represent a total population of speakers numbering just over one thousand million. We only have numbers—God, Who knows each star by name, knows each one of the souls in each country and people group. They are part of the ‘world’ for which God gave His only-begotten Son.

Do you know someone who knows one of the listed languages? Or, will you pray for a specific language, that God may lead us to a translator? Or, will you “Adopt” a language where we may locate a Christian brother or sister in an economically distressed area who can help us? We already have paid for a few languages in Africa and Asia - $200 for acceptable translation of the six most vital stories in the 60 story series. (A complete language translation of 60 stories could be done for somewhat more.)

Paying recommended translators, especially in Third World countries, gives us the privilege of helping translators and their families financially while they maintain their dignity by doing what they can do (translate) in service to our glorious Lord.
